A Word from Frank HamiltonThe word "defiance" occurred to me from the reading of Gene Sharp, an amazing gentleman living in East Boston who through his great book on non-violent resistance called "From Dictatorship to Democracy" (full book here as free download) has managed to influence world events such as The Arab Spring in Tunisia and Egypt, the Velvet Revolution and others through his Albert Einstein Institute. He uses the term "political defiance" as part of his non-violent revolutionary approach to authoritarianism. Robbie Lieberman's book, "My Song is My Weapon" gave me the idea to put her treatise together with Gene Sharp's term. Since we are a song-oriented community, it made sense that we should follow Sharp's advice and use our music as a way of counteracting the Trump and reactionary so-called right wing agenda through satire, songs, and stories. I believe in non-violent revolution to overthrow the tendency toward fascism in the U.S. I also believe that as Robbie put it in her book, "A song can change the world."
